EDITORS COMMENTS
Amico Aspertini's Portrait of a Young Woman as a Saint, created around 1510-1520, is a captivating work of art that beautifully blends the worlds of portraiture and devotion. This stunning oil on wood panel painting originates from Bologna, Italy, and showcases the young woman in a pious and contemplative pose, with a prayer book in her hands and a serious yet gentle expression on her face. The young woman's dark attire and the black background add an air of solemnity and mystery to the image, while her direct gaze and slight smile convey a sense of inner peace and connection to her faith. The intricate headdress adorning her head further emphasizes her saintly status, making this a truly remarkable representation of Christian piety during the Renaissance period. The portrait's rich, dark colors and meticulous attention to detail are a testament to Aspertini's masterful painting techniques. The neckline of her gown, delicately outlined in brown, adds a touch of sensuality to the otherwise austere image. This work of art, now housed at the Walters Art Museum, invites us to contemplate the intersection of personal identity and spiritual devotion during the 16th century.
